Disability Pride Month is observed each July to commemorate the anniversary of the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), which was signed into law on July 26, 1990. This landmark legislation protects people with disabilities from discrimination in employment, education, transportation, and public spaces, helping to create a more accessible and inclusive society.
Disability Pride Month is both a celebration and a call to action. It recognizes the contributions, experiences, and identities of people with disabilities while challenging stereotypes and stigma. Rather than viewing disability solely as something to be overcome, Disability Pride embraces it as a natural and valuable part of human diversity.
